Output e2e2589abf5070d74d4627da1dbe3cfefd35e55262e41a4a2dc9ebb0cea4d33e:0

value
7015238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de3057d077eee047d1a52fa4258fac59d8971031 OP_EQUAL
address
3Mwqr4a168W1nd34r1JvpnD32BcAAcrHS7
transaction
e2e2589abf5070d74d4627da1dbe3cfefd35e55262e41a4a2dc9ebb0cea4d33e
confirmations
140561
spent
true